Games by Aydy - Steam Publisher Stats

Name Release Date Current Players All-Time Peak Rating
Creepless Creepless 22 Jun, 2023 0 0 65.67
Somewhere in the Shadow Somewhere in the Shadow 23 Aug, 2021 0 16 75.29
File uploading